The escalating global climate crisis demands immediate and multifaceted solutions. Education plays a crucial, often overlooked, role in mitigating climate change. By fostering environmental awareness and promoting sustainable practices, educational initiatives can empower individuals to make informed choices and contribute to collective action. However, the pervasive influence of smartphones presents both opportunities and challenges in this endeavor. On one hand, smartphones offer unparalleled access to information. Educational apps, online courses, and documentaries readily available on these devices can enhance climate literacy, enabling individuals to understand the complexities of climate change and its impact. Moreover, social media platforms, accessible through smartphones, can facilitate communication and collaboration among environmental activists, fostering a sense of community and shared responsibility. Citizen science projects, utilizing smartphone technology to gather data on local environmental conditions, provide hands-on opportunities for engagement. On the other hand, smartphones also contribute to the environmental problem. Their manufacturing processes are resource-intensive and generate significant electronic waste. Furthermore, the energy consumption associated with smartphone use, including data transmission and the operation of data centers, contributes to greenhouse gas emissions. The addictive nature of smartphones can also divert attention from more impactful forms of engagement in environmental action, such as volunteering or political advocacy. The constant stream of information, much of it superficial, can lead to information overload and a sense of helplessness rather than empowerment. Therefore, the effective integration of smartphones into climate change education requires a nuanced approach. Educational initiatives should leverage the positive aspects of smartphone technology while mitigating its negative environmental impacts. Critical thinking skills are essential to navigate the overwhelming flow of information and identify reliable sources. Furthermore, promoting responsible smartphone usage, including minimizing energy consumption and reducing e-waste, is crucial. Ultimately, education must foster a sense of agency and empower individuals to become active participants in tackling climate change, utilizing technology responsibly and effectively.
